Sommario:

Come si fa a testare i cetrioli?
Come si fa a testare i cetrioli?

Video: Come si fa a testare i cetrioli?

Video: Come si fa a testare i cetrioli?
Video: CETRIOLI come coltivarli, concimarli, annaffiarli, potarli e le malattie 2024, Luglio
Anonim

Introduzione alla scrittura di test di accettazione con Cucumber

  1. Scrivi il tuo test di accettazione.
  2. Guardalo fallire in modo da sapere qual è il prossimo passo.
  3. Scrivi un test di unità per il passaggio successivo.
  4. Guardalo fallire in modo da sapere quale deve essere l'implementazione.
  5. Ripeti i passaggi 3 e 4 finché non hai tutto ciò di cui hai bisogno e tutti i tuoi test (incluso quello di accettazione) stanno passando.

Rispetto a questo, cosa sta testando il cetriolo?

UN cetriolo è uno strumento basato sul framework Behavior Driven Development (BDD) che viene utilizzato per scrivere l'accettazione test per l'applicazione web. Consente l'automazione della convalida funzionale in un formato facilmente leggibile e comprensibile (come l'inglese semplice) per analisti aziendali, sviluppatori, tester, ecc.

Oltre sopra, i cetrioli sono gratis? Cetriolo è uno di questi strumenti open source, che supporta lo sviluppo guidato dal comportamento. Per essere più precisi, Cetriolo può essere definito come un framework di test, guidato da un semplice testo in inglese. Serve come documentazione, test automatizzati e aiuto allo sviluppo, tutto in uno.

Semplicemente, il cetriolo è un test unitario?

Puoi implementare end-to-end test , integrazione test e parti che potrebbero essere testate utilizzando test unitari . La decisione di utilizzare Cetriolo o un test dell'unità quadro dipende dalla cooperazione con l'impresa. Se hanno opinioni sul comportamento, usa Cetriolo.

Il selenio è TDD o BDD?

TDD : TDD è una tecnica di sviluppo software che prevede la scrittura di casi di test automatizzati prima di scrivere parti funzionali del codice. Selenio è uno strumento di automazione per automatizzare i browser Web, mentre TDD e BDD sono approccio di progettazione del quadro. È possibile implementare entrambi i modelli di progettazione utilizzando Selenio.

Consigliato: